在现代社会中,GitHub已经成为了开发者们进行版本控制和协作开发的重要平台。很多开发者在注册GitHub时使用了自己的邮箱,这就为我们提供了一个通过邮箱查找GitHub账号的可能性。本文将详细介绍如何通过邮箱查找GitHub账号,具体步骤、注意事项以及常见问题解答。
目录
什么是GitHub账号
GitHub账号是用户在GitHub平台上注册后所获得的身份标识。用户可以在GitHub上进行代码托管、版本控制、协作开发等操作。一个GitHub账号通常与用户的邮箱地址关联。由于许多开发者使用自己的邮箱进行注册,因此通过邮箱查找GitHub账号成为一种可行的方法。
为什么要通过邮箱查找GitHub账号
通过邮箱查找GitHub账号的理由有很多,主要包括:
- 找回丢失的账号:如果用户忘记了自己的GitHub用户名或密码,通过邮箱可以找到相关的账户信息。
- 查看他人账户:在进行项目协作时,可能需要查看某个开发者的GitHub账号来了解其过往项目和贡献。
- 安全审计:如果你担心自己的邮箱是否被用来注册了不当的GitHub账号,查找功能也非常有用。
通过邮箱查找GitHub账号的方法
以下是几种常用的方法,通过邮箱查找GitHub账号:
1. 使用GitHub搜索功能
GitHub提供了一个搜索功能,用户可以在上面直接输入邮箱进行搜索。
- 步骤:
- 登录到你的GitHub账号。
- 在搜索框中输入目标邮箱。
- 观察搜索结果,如果该邮箱关联有GitHub账号,将会显示相关信息。
2. 通过Google搜索
利用Google等搜索引擎的强大功能,用户可以通过在搜索框中输入site:github.com [你的邮箱]
来查找相关账号。
- 步骤:
- 打开Google搜索页面。
- 输入
site:github.com your_email@example.com
,替换为你想查找的邮箱。 - 查看搜索结果,寻找与该邮箱相关的GitHub账号。
3. 使用第三方工具
市面上有一些第三方工具可以帮助用户通过邮箱查找GitHub账号,但使用时要注意其安全性和可靠性。
- 常见工具:
- Email to GitHub Lookup Tool
- GitHub API Explorer
使用API通过邮箱查找GitHub账号
如果你对编程感兴趣,可以使用GitHub提供的API进行查询。通过API,你可以获取更详细的信息。具体步骤如下:
- 步骤:
- 注册GitHub API Token。
- 使用相关的API Endpoint,例如
/users/[username]
,根据输入的邮箱地址获取用户信息。
API示例
bash curl -H ‘Authorization: token YOUR_TOKEN’ https://api.github.com/users/USERNAME
注意事项
- GitHub的API查询限制可能会影响查询结果。
- 通过API查找可能需要一定的编程知识。
如何保护自己的邮箱信息
随着信息安全问题的日益严重,保护个人邮箱信息显得尤为重要。以下是一些建议:
- 使用复杂的密码:确保邮箱账户的密码足够复杂,不易被破解。
- 开启双重验证:使用双重验证功能增加账户的安全性。
- 避免公开邮箱:在社交媒体或公共论坛中,尽量不要公开自己的邮箱信息。
常见问题解答
如何找到我自己的GitHub账号?
你可以使用邮箱登录GitHub,或者在GitHub登录界面点击“忘记密码”,输入你的邮箱,GitHub会向你发送重置密码的链接。
有没有办法在不登录的情况下查找GitHub账号?
是的,可以使用Google搜索或其他搜索引擎通过输入邮箱来尝试找到关联的GitHub账号。
如果邮箱没有找到任何GitHub账号怎么办?
可能是因为该邮箱没有注册GitHub账号,或者用户在注册时使用了其他的邮箱。你可以尝试其他可能的邮箱进行搜索。
如何提高邮箱的安全性以防止信息泄露?
使用强密码、定期更改密码、开启双重验证以及定期检查账户的活动记录。
可以通过手机号码查找GitHub账号吗?
目前GitHub并不支持通过手机号码直接查找账号。
通过邮箱找GitHub账号是否合法?
如果你是出于合理的目的(如查找自己的账号),则合法。但若用于恶意目的,则可能会涉及法律问题。
以上就是通过邮箱查找GitHub账号的详细指南,希望对你有所帮助!如果你有其他疑问,欢迎随时提问。